    Notes: Abstract A study was done of the possible association between the development of common bile-duct stones and the presence of worms in rats experimentally infected with Fasciola hepatica. A total of 157 rats were individually infected with 20 metacercariae, and another 40 animals served as controls. The rats were dissected at 100, 200, 300, and 400 days postinfection (p.i.). A significant association was observed between the observation of stones and the presence of F. hepatica adults. The global frequency of bile-duct lithiasis in the parasitized rats was 22%, with a significantly lower incidence being observed in the younger group (100 days p.i.). Different analytical techniques were used to determine the main stone components. Energy-dispersive X-ray microanalysis showed calcium to be the main component in all cases (82–94%). Scanning electron microscopy, nuclear magnetic resonance ([1H]- and [13C]-NMR), and mass spectrometry revealed the predominance of palmitic (C-16) and stearic (C-18) acid.

    Notes: Abstract The finding of natural infection of Rattus rattus by Fasciola hepatica on Corsica has stimulated further research into the role of the black rat in the epidemiology of fascioliasis. Corsican black rats were experimentally individually infected with 20 metacercariae from cattle and murine isolates obtained from naturally infected bovines and black rats. The following results were obtained: (a) in R. rattus infected with the cattle isolate, normal adult fluke development took place and infection persisted for a long period, with emission of eggs showing embryogenic capacity; (b) the development of F. hepatica adults paralleled the ontogenetic trajectories observed in other rodent-F. hepatica models; and (c) fluke adults obtained in R. rattus infected with the murine isolate exhibited a similar pattern. These findings strongly suggest that the black rat may be one of the wild reservoirs of F. hepatica and may have contributed to the large geographical extent of the disease on Corsica.
